Default 92 eg will not start or crank

What's up guys.
Okay so I got a 92 eg with an f20b swap in it.
I was drivin home the other day on the highway an shifted to fifth with a little grind and then the car just started to rev without it getting power so I coasted to the side if the road an on my way the car just shut off and would not start back up. Since then I have changed the timing belt because it was shot. It didn't snap but it was missing some teeth. The timing was set perfect by the way. After that was changed I went to try and start the car but it did not crank at all. The fuel pump kicks on but the cr doesn't even try to start. I had my starter checked the other day and it work fine. Prior to me coming home when it all happened the car wouldn't start either so me an my buddies pop started it and it ran fine. This is my only car and would like to figure this out ASAP. Any help you guys can give me would be great

Default Re: 92 eg will not start or crank

Check to see if your getting 12 volts to the little wire on the starter solenoid. It could be a bad connection,bad fuse,bad relay or bad ignition switch.all so check and make sure your grounds are good and clean.

Default Re: 92 eg will not start or crank

I agree with the timing.
If you were having problems with starting before, but it bump started, check to see if your clutch pedal still has the little rubber piece in it that hits the switch. My friends eg just did that to him about 2 weeks ago. We just looped the wires and it fired right up.
